Liga Nacional de Fútbol Americano (LNFA) is the name of the top American football league which operates in Spain. It was founded in 1995 after the merge of several previous Spanish competitions.

The league is run by the Spanish Federation of American Football (Federación Española de Futbol Americano (FEFA) in Spanish language).

At the end of the season, league's champion and runner up clinch bids to compete at next year's European Football League, while third and fourth teams classify for the EFAF Cup.

There has been changes in the number of teams throughout the years. Since 2015, teams are divided into three categories: Serie A, with the top six teams, second tier Serie B with 10 teams compiting in 2 conferences, and Serie C, with regional and interregional leagues.

LNFA Serie B

The Serie B is the second division of the LNFA. It was created in 2012 and named originally as LNFA while the top league was called LNFA Elite. In 2014, it changed the name to Serie B.

LNFA Serie C

The Serie C is the third division of the LNFA. It was created in 2015 with the aim to get more teams in the national leagues.
